I asked Kingwa about DSD and he kindly responded. I am so wrong about DSD decoding and other assumptions. The list is long so where do I begin?
DSD native only is used. DoP is not needed nor any extra control wires. DSD is recognized by bits in the 32 bit (2 x 16bits) DSD native frame. DSD native stuff is decoded on the R2R analog/DAC boards and not the Singularity DSP FPGA. Here’s what Kingwa says... “The R2R DAC all built in DSD native decoders which is separate to the PCM decoders. It is working with 1bit but with 32bit resistors to finished the decode.”
The R7 DAC boards support DSD512 and best served by HDMI inputs. Kingwa mentioned the Amanero USB issue (noise in one channel playing DSD512) and no fault of the R7’s other circuits. Kingwa has the same Amanero issue with SD DACs that use ES9038 DSD chips.
When is the R8 DAC being released for the Europe and the Americas? Soon. Kingwa is certifying the DAC now (safety testing like UL and EMI radiation) so the unit can carry the “CE” mark on its label. Otherwise no import into Europe until complete.
